Transaction e17c95439dc804bf16b8f929f625256003b49ce054622324883e8dd954f68c4b
1 Input
1 Output
-
e17c95439dc804bf16b8f929f625256003b49ce054622324883e8dd954f68c4b:0
- value
- 325094
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 168651ab182e86faaf61e908f2611c4cbe67e339 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1346msQvDwBQPZkssT78Pz5Trfc5mohyBT